Why Kansas is a Prime Location for Aviation Career Scholarships
Kansas has a unique blend of aviation history, educational institutions, and industry presence that makes it an ideal location for the Aviation Career Scholarships. The state's central location in the United States, coupled with its rich aviation heritage, provides a distinct advantage for students pursuing careers in commercial aviation.
The Kansas Department of Commerce is actively involved in promoting the state's aviation industry, which includes a strong presence of aviation-related businesses and educational programs. For instance, the state is home to several institutions offering degree programs in aviation-related fields such as aeronautical engineering, aviation management, and airport management. The Aviation Career Scholarships will complement these existing programs by providing financial assistance to academically qualified students.
One of the distinguishing geographic features of Kansas is its vast rural landscape, which includes frontier counties. This characteristic presents both opportunities and challenges for the aviation industry. On one hand, the rural nature of much of Kansas can make it difficult for students in these areas to access educational resources. On the other hand, the state's aviation programs can help bridge this gap by providing scholarships to students from rural areas, thereby fostering a more diverse and widespread talent pool in the aviation sector.
Kansas's aviation industry is also supported by its strategic location near the geographic center of the contiguous United States. This central location makes Kansas an attractive hub for logistics and transportation companies, including those in the aviation sector. The state's airports, such as the Kansas City International Airport and the Wichita Dwight D. Eisenhower National Airport, play critical roles in the regional and national aviation infrastructure.

Q: What are the primary aviation-related fields that the scholarships in Kansas will support? A: The Aviation Career Scholarships in Kansas will support students enrolled in programs related to commercial aviation, including aviation finance, aviation law, aeronautical engineering, aviation management, aeronautical science, aviation computer science, aviation maintenance, and airport management.
